Kuhnemann a ‘live chance’ for Test debut in Delhi | India v Australia 2023



Brought into Australia’s squad for state teammate Mitchell Swepson who departs for the birth of his first child, coach Andrew McDonald says left-arm spinner Matthew Kuhnemann is every chance of playing in the second Test in Delhi.
